COLOGNE, Germany – Wolfgang Link, a veteran German TV executive and producer of hit entertainment show The Voice of Germany, has taken over as managing director of ProSiebenSat.1 TV Deutschland, overseeing all of the media group’s channels in Germany.

Link replaces Jurgen Horner, who has been ProSiebenSat.1 head since July, 2012. Horner said he is leaving on his own accord to set up his own media firm.
Link has run the group’s flagship channel, Pro7, for more than a year now, where he has boosted ratings and market share. In September, Pro7 took a 12 percent share of the key 14-49 demographic, coming within shouting distance of market leader RTL, which has 13.2 percent.
